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Kap-Stachelmaus | Yellowback stingaree |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Tier) | Animalia (Tier)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ordatiere) | Chordata (Chordatiere) |
| Class | Mammalia (Säugetiere) | Elasmobranchii |
| Order | Rodentia (Nagetiere) | Myliobatiformes (Stechrochenartige)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Urolophidae |
| Genus | Acomys | Urolophus |
| Species | Acomys subspinosus | Urolophus sufflavus |
